Featuring members of Avenged Sevenfold and Ballistico, this is some manic metal. Acrobatic drums, guitar, and vocals, with lyrics describing vampires and morbidly twisted plots.
"Pinkly Smooth was formed in the summer of 2001, in Huntington Beach, CA and in 2002, they recorded the legendary metal album, "Unfortunate Snort," on Bucktan records. While the lead guitarist and drummer of AVENGED SEVENFOLD, (Synyster Gates & The Reverend), and the lead singer and drummer of BALLISTICO (Buck Silverspur & D-Rock), are on break from touring with their bands, rather than lounging by a hotel pool with a bottle of Old Grand Dad Whiskey, they transform into the mentally deranged... PINKLY SMOOTH! There are many hints that PS's inspiration springs from bands like; Queen, (with their opera-atic vocal harmonies), Meshuggah, (with counter time drumming and guitar riffs), and Danny Elfman, (with Klezmer-like Piano parts from Pee Wee's big adventure)."
